Output 86a7656399616d1d60f69a0460bdd5dd6981268bfe76dcba59ce5f6e28ff5d22:2

value
248910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c75ee05d9e44b247e867a7d5e687367bf020a697 OP_EQUAL
address
3KsC3r8Lx1dsxvrmAnDVmgUuaQEpXBpEJc
transaction
86a7656399616d1d60f69a0460bdd5dd6981268bfe76dcba59ce5f6e28ff5d22
spent
true